## Step-by-Step: Using a Bitcoin Blockchain Traveler.
When I initially used a ** blockchain explorer Bitcoin **, I wasn't certain what to key in. Here's exactly how I at some point found out to track BTC step by step:.
1. ** Find your deal ID (TXID): **.
After sending out Bitcoin, your pocketbook or exchange will usually provide you a deal here ID. This resembles a electronic receipt number.
2. ** Paste it into the explorer search bar: **.
On a ** blockchain explorer BTC web site ** such as Blockchain.com or Blockchair, I pasted my TXID.
3. ** Sight purchase details: **.
Instantly, I might see the sender, receiver, deal cost, and whether it remained in the ** mempool ** (unconfirmed) or had been included in a block ( verified).
4. ** Inspect verifications: **.
Each block included after your own is counted as a verification. For Bitcoin, most services require 3-- 6 confirmations for full safety and security.
This basic procedure provided me comfort. As opposed to asking yourself if my BTC was shed, I can essentially see it move across the blockchain.

## Ethereum Blockchain Traveler Walkthrough.
Ethereum travelers are advanced than Bitcoin's, mainly because of ** smart agreements **. Below's just how I make use of an ** traveler blockchain Ethereum ** (like Etherscan):.
1. ** Look your Ethereum address: **.
I replicate my ETH pocketbook address and paste it right into the search bar. Quickly, it reveals my equilibrium in ETH, plus every token (like USDT, DAI, or web link) connected to that purse.
2. ** Inspect token transfers: **.
By clicking the "Token Transfers" tab, I can see movements of ERC-20 tokens. For example, when I send ** blockchain explorer USDT **, I see the exact transfer logged on the Tether clever agreement.
3. ** Smart agreement interactions: **.
I when staked tokens on a DeFi application, and by examining my address on Etherscan, I might really see the contract call and the function implemented. It seemed like looking under the hood of DeFi.
4. ** Verify deal status: **.
Just like Bitcoin, Ethereum purchases relocate from "pending" (in the mempool) to " verified." The explorer reveals gas costs and exactly how rapidly validators picked up the purchase.
What blew my mind was just how much info a blockchain explorer discloses. Also stopped working transactions (where I really did not pay sufficient gas) appeared, helping me find out exactly how to avoid blunders.

## Comparing Different Blockchain Explorers.
Gradually, I've evaluated loads of explorers. Right here's what I located when comparing a few of one of the most popular ones:.
* ** Bitcoin (BTC): ** Blockchain.com, Blockchair, BTC.com.
* ** Ethereum (ETH): ** Etherscan, Ethplorer, Blockchair.
* ** TRON (TRC20): ** Tronscan.
* ** Solana (SOL): ** Solscan, Solana Explorer.
* ** BNB Chain (BSC): ** BscScan.
* ** XRP: ** XRPScan.
* ** Litecoin (LTC): ** Blockcypher, Blockchair.
Each has its very own strengths. For instance, Etherscan is a gold criterion for Ethereum because of its clarity and information. Tronscan is irresistible for TRON because it directly sustains ** blockchain traveler USDT TRC20 **.
The trick is easy: constantly select the explorer native to the blockchain you're utilizing.

## Common Mistakes When Making Use Of Blockchain Explorers.
I have actually made a couple of mistakes along the road, and below are one of the most usual blunders to stay clear of:.
* ** Examining the incorrect chain: ** Sending out USDT on TRON and afterwards browsing Etherscan will not function. You need to utilize a ** tron blockchain traveler ** for TRC20.
* ** Complicated unconfirmed with failed transactions: ** Just because it's stuck in the ** mempool ** doesn't mean it failed-- it might simply require greater charges.
* ** Not double-checking addresses: ** An explorer shows if you pasted the wrong wallet. Always validate the ** blockchain traveler address ** matches what you planned.
Discovering from these errors saved me from unnecessary panic more than as soon as.

## Enhanced FAQs.
** Exactly how do I recognize if my Bitcoin transaction is stuck? **.
Paste your ** deal ID ** right into a ** blockchain explorer BTC ** site. If it reveals as " unofficial" in the ** mempool **, it implies miners have not included it to a block yet. Sometimes this occurs if you establish also low a fee. You can wait, or attempt " change by fee" (RBF) if your purse sustains it.
** What's the most effective explorer for Ethereum DeFi? **.
Pass on, ** Etherscan **. This ** ETH blockchain traveler ** lets you not only examine ETH equilibriums but likewise track token authorizations, liquidity swimming pool communications, and even stopped working agreement telephone calls. If you're serious about DeFi, it's the best tool.
** Can I see who has a budget making use of an explorer? **.
No. Blockchain explorers show ** addresses **, not identities. You can see equilibriums and purchases connected to an address, but not the real-world person behind it. Some exchanges have understood budgets classified, yet private individuals remain anonymous unless they expose themselves.
